NILES, Ohio – Five pitches into Tuesday night's game Kent State (20-12) had a 2-0 lead and that led them to cruise to a 6-3 victory at Youngstown State (9-24).
The game started with singles by Mason Mamarella and Luke Burch. Dylan Rosa then took the first pitch he saw and doubled to left center for the lead. The fast start did not stop there, as Tim DalPorto walked to put two on for another two-run double. Pete Schuler took an 0-2 pitch and placed it down the right field line to make it a 4-0 game.
